Thelma A. Cheney, age 95, died peacefully at the home of her daughter in Stockbridge MI, on December 5th, 2018, with her family at her side.
Thelma was born in Ithaca on October 21st, 1923, the daughter of Alfred Amos and Edna Gladys (Wilson) Plank. On May 8th, 1943 she married Ralph W. Cheney. He preceded her in death on July 7th, 1980.
Thelma was quick witted and was always working with her hands. She enjoyed cooking and needlework, along with many other hobbies. She also taught cake decorating for several years and made wedding cakes for her family. Even when her children had families of their own, she was always concerned about their well being. With all the love in her heart, it's easy to see that family meant everything to her.
